/*
Imsd:Messages — the SIP request/response text the engine puts on the wire.
Every VoLTE message the daemon sends is assembled here from an explicit
context and the per-request variables (tags, branches, CSeq) so the builders
are pure functions with no hidden state: the engine owns the dialog bookkeeping
and the transport owns the socket, this module only formats bytes. That makes
each message byte-pinnable — tests/Messages compares the output against strings
cross-generated from the Python reference stack, header for header.
Covers: the unprotected + protected REGISTER and the refresh re-REGISTER
(sec-agree, Security-Client/Verify, AKAv1-MD5 Authorization); the INVITE with
an AMR-WB SDP offer and IMS MMTEL feature tags; the in-dialog PRACK/BYE and
2xx/non-2xx ACK; CANCEL (reusing the INVITE branch); the 200 OK that echoes
an inbound request's dialog headers; and the UAS responses to an inbound
INVITE (100/180/200 and rejection finals). Pure std C++.
*/

// A Via line: "Via: SIP/2.0/<transport> [local]:<port>;branch=z9hG4bK<b>;rport".
//
// Port rule (TS 24.229 5.1.1.4 / 33.203): every PROTECTED request carries
// the protected SERVER port (portUs) in Via and Contact — that is the
// port the network delivers terminating requests to (MT INVITE, NOTIFY,
// in-dialog requests toward us). The protected CLIENT port (portUc) is
// only the source port of the TCP connection we open; it never appears
// in headers. Getting this wrong is invisible on the originating path
// (TCP responses ride our own connection regardless) but silently kills
// ALL terminating delivery: the P-CSCF has no deliverable flow toward a
// Contact naming portUc, so MT calls fall back to CS and reg-event
// NOTIFYs vanish (found live 2026-07-20; the stock modem puts its
// port_us in both Via and Contact).
inline std::string ViaLine(const Context& c, std::string_view transport, int port, std::string_view branch) {
return std::format("Via: SIP/2.0/{} {};branch=z9hG4bK{};rport", transport, imsd::util::HostPort(c.local, port), branch);
}

// REGISTER Contact media-feature tags. The MMTEL ICSI declares the
// binding VOICE-capable: terminating access-domain selection only routes
// incoming calls to contacts registered with it — without the tag the
// network diverts straight to voicemail (KPN, observed live 2026-07-20;
// the stock modem registers with exactly this ICSI). The URN colons are
// percent-encoded (TS 24.229 7.2A.8.2 feature-tag coding; RFC 3841
// matching compares the value as a string, so the encoding must match
// what the network selects on — the stock modem sends exactly
// urn%3Aurn-7%3A..., diag capture 2026-07-18). +sip.instance carries the
// IMEI URN when known. Deliberately NOT +g.3gpp.smsip: it routes
// terminating SMS over IMS to a stack with no SMSoIP handling yet,
// silently losing texts — and exact tag parity including smsip +
// nw-init-ussi was tested live (2026-07-20, stored binding echo-verified)
// and did NOT change terminating access-domain selection, so the tags
// buy nothing.

// A protected REGISTER over the IPsec/TCP flow. Always advertises
// Supported: sec-agree, path — RFC 3327: 'path' here is the UA's
// declaration that it is reachable via the Path the P-CSCF inserted,
// i.e. the route every terminating request (NOTIFY, MT INVITE) takes.
// The stock oracle sends it in BOTH REGISTERs (2026-07-21 capture,
// reg2 build at 19:30:44); an earlier reading that reg2 omits it was
// wrong and cost us all terminating delivery. `authLine` is a full
// Authorization line (AuthEmpty for the refresh's first try, AuthAka
// once challenged).

// SUBSCRIBE to the registration event package (RFC 3680) for our own
// AOR — TS 24.229 5.1.1.3 requires it after registration. The immediate
// NOTIFY carries application/reginfo+xml with every binding the S-CSCF
// holds for the implicit registration set, feature tags as stored — the
// network's own view of what terminating routing selects on. Same
// sec-agree/route shape as the other protected in-flow requests; a new
// dialog (fresh Call-ID, CSeq 1) per subscription.

// A response to an inbound INVITE — the UAS side of call setup. Unlike
// BuildResponse200 (first Via only, fine for hop-by-hop CANCEL/BYE
// answers), an INVITE response travels the whole proxy chain back to the
// caller: it must echo EVERY Via in order, return the Record-Route set on
// dialog-establishing (1xx/2xx) responses, and mint the dialog's local
// half by tagging To (all but 100 Trying, which is hop-by-hop and
// tagless). 1xx/2xx carry our Contact (the dialog's remote target for the
// caller) and Allow; `extra` appends headers (RSeq, Session-Expires...);
// `sdp` turns a 200 into the answer.
